How do I get a New Key

Your Nissan car key is your pass for all driving adventures. So if yours gets lost or stolen, or is damaged beyond repair by the elements, it'll put the entire amount of your plans for your next road trip. Fortunately, there are various options to get a replacement for your nissan car keys fob or key.

The first option is to visit the dealership. You'll need to bring ID and proof of ownership like your registration or title. The dealer will then make a replacement key for you, which is usually less expensive than visiting locksmiths or buying one online.

Some locksmiths are able to offer replacement Nissan keys at much cheaper than the dealership However, you should ensure that the locksmith you choose is certified and licensed. They must also have the correct equipment and know how to program your new key correctly.

Keep an accurate record of the key code for your Nissan. This will make the process more efficient and speedier. You can get the key code from the dealership (which will be free if you are an owner registered) or through a third-party retailer with the correct key for the year and model. You may also be able to locate the key code in the owner's manual, or in the Nissan warranty to determine if it's covered under the protection plan of the automaker.

In the past, the majority of automobiles had simple metal keys that fitted into the ignition cylinder and lock cylinder. Modern technology in Nissan vehicles has led them to create intelligent key fobs that connect with the computer system of the vehicle to allow it to unlock and start it.

These smart keys need to be programmed to work with your vehicle's security and security features. You'll need a locksmith with specialized skills to accomplish this task.

When you go to the locksmith, be sure to bring proof of ownership. They will require your driver's license, current registration for the vehicle and the VIN number. The key replacement process can take longer if you do not have these documents. It is also recommended to have a spare made in order to have backup in the event you lose the original.

A replacement key can be made at the dealership

Nissan dealers can make you an alternative key. It will cost more than a local locksmith but the process will be quicker. You can also get an identical key to your original.

First, confirm that your car is equipped with transponders. If it does, you'll need to order the key from the manufacturer. Additionally, you'll need proof of ownership. The dealer will then match the new computer chip to your vehicle. The process may take several days. A replacement key for a nissan smart key that has a push-button start is more expensive since it requires the dealer to test the operation of the key as well as the car.

If your car has a normal keyblade, you can copy it at a hardware store or auto parts dealer. Most modern Nissan vehicles come with keys that are equipped with an internal transponder. You can find the code for this by looking through the windshield on the driver's side of the vehicle. You can also check the sticker on the driver's side of your door, your vehicle registration card or your insurance card to locate the code.

Some local locksmiths do not have the required equipment to program these keys. It is also advisable to check with the manufacturer of your car to determine if they provide any replacement service for damaged or lost keys.

It isn't easy to replace the smart keys found on modern Nissan vehicles. These keys have transponders that send an electronic code to the vehicle. To program a brand new Nissan key with smart technology to match the code, it has to be programmed.
